
US President Joe Biden called Russian President Vladimir Putin a war criminal on Monday, and said he would call for a war crimes trial.
“You saw what happened in Bucha,” Biden said. He added that Putin “is a war criminal”
Biden also said he would seek more sanctions after reported atrocities in Ukraine, but his comments to reporters did not go as far as calling the actions genocide.
“We have to continue to provide Ukraine with the weapons they need to continue the fight. And we have to gather all the detail so this can be an actual – have a war crimes trial,” Biden said, according to remarks posted by Associated Press.
Biden lashed out at Putin as “brutal.”
“What’s happening in Bucha is outrageous and everyone sees it,” Biden added.
In a separate move, a senior US defence official informed Reuters that the US believes Russia has repositioned about two thirds of its forces from around Kyiv, with many of them consolidating in Belarus. They anticipate they will be re-directed to the east of Ukraine, but that is not yet confirmed./TheGuardian/
